Permutation on string
WebApr 14, 2024 · Naive Approach: The simplest approach is to generate all permutations of the given array and check if there exists an arrangement in which the sum of no two adjacent elements is divisible by 3.If it is found to be true, then print “Yes”.Otherwise, print “No”. Time Complexity: O(N!) Auxiliary Space: O(1) Efficient Approach: To optimize the above … WebApr 9, 2013 · permutations Share Cite Follow asked Apr 9, 2013 at 23:58 Emily 1 1 You need to be more specific in your question. A bit string is just a string of 0 's and 1 's, often of a given length. You might wonder, for example, how many five …
Permutation on string
Did you know?
WebOct 5, 2024 · Let’s take a look at what we’ve done here: We imported the itertools library We loaded our string and assigned it to the variable a_string We then used the permutations () function to create a itertools object We turned this object into a list, which returned a list … WebAug 19, 2024 · Backtracking is a general algorithm "that incrementally builds candidates to the solutions, and abandons each partial candidate ("backtracks") as soon as it determines that the candidate cannot possibly be completed to a valid solution."(Wikipedia). So, basically, what you do is build incrementally all permutations. As soon as as you build a …
WebAlgorithm for Permutations of a Given String Using STL. Permutation also called an “arrangement number” or “order”, is a rearrangement of the elements of an ordered list S into a one-to-one correspondence with S itself. A string of length n has n! permutation. WebApr 15, 2024 · 104, Building No. 5, Sector 3, Millennium Business Park, Mahape, Navi Mumbai - 400710
WebNov 23, 2024 · Permutations is not an easy problem. For those who haven’t seen a backtracking question before, there is no clear naive solution, and this poses a real threat for software engineers during interviews.. Luckily, there is a method for solving questions like Permutations. In this article, the question will be broken down and then be solved using … WebMay 18, 2024 · This lecture explains how to find and print all the permutations of a given string. This lecture involves two example explanations followed by code logic explanation for printing and …
WebGiven an array nums of distinct integers, return all the possible permutations.You can return the answer in any order.. Example 1: Input: nums = [1,2,3] Output: [[1,2 ...
WebMay 14, 2024 · Finding the middle permutation. This method finds all permutations of a string and stores them in a sorted array. It then returns the element in the middle of the array. def middle_permutation (string) sorted = string.chars.to_a.permutation.map (&:join).sort sorted [sorted.length / 2 - 1] end. For strings over 10+ characters this code is … ウエアハウス 4601 縮みWebAug 3, 2024 · Algorithm for Permutation of a String in Java We will first take the first character from the String and permute with the remaining chars. If String = “ABC” First char = A and remaining chars permutations are BC and CB. Now we can insert first char in the … pagopa chebancaWebPermutation in String - Given two strings s1 and s2, return true if s2 contains a permutation of s1, or false otherwise. In other words, return true if one of s1's permutations is the substring of s2. Example 1: Input: s1 = "ab", s2 = "eidbaooo" Output: true Explanation: s2 … pago pa cefaluWebMay 18, 2024 · This lecture explains how to find and print all the permutations of a given string. This lecture involves two example explanations followed by code logic explanation for printing and … pagopa cesenaWebJun 19, 2012 · This function is much faster than combinat::permn with a larger number of permutations. For example: microbenchmark:microbenchmark (permn (letters [1:9]), matrix (letters [permutations (9)],ncol=9), times=20) – Anthony May 21, 2024 at 19:44 Add a comment 60 combinat::permn will do that work: ウエアハウス dd1004WebPermutations of a given string Medium Accuracy: 34.65% Submissions: 195K+ Points: 4 Given a string S. The task is to print all unique permutations of the given string in lexicographically sorted order. Example 1: Input: ABC Output: ABC ACB BAC BCA CAB … ウエア ハウス dd s1003xx 1944WebJan 6, 2024 · Permutation in String The Problem Given two strings s1 (queryStr) and s2 (sourceStr), return true if s2 contains a permutation of s1, or false otherwise.In other words, return true if one of s1's permutations is the substring of s2. I had 3 goals in mind: ウエアハウス dsb s1003xx